The Benefits of Exercise for Mental Health

In today’s fast-paced world, stress and anxiety have become all too common. The pressures of work, relationships, and life, in general, can take a toll on our mental well-being. However, one effective way to combat these issues is through exercise. Regular physical activity not only helps maintain a healthy body but also has significant benefits for our mental health.

Exercise has been proven to reduce symptoms of anxiety and depression. Engaging in physical activities such as walking, running, cycling, or even participating in team sports release feel-good chemicals in the brain, called endorphins. These endorphins act as natural mood boosters, alleviating symptoms of anxiety and depression. The release of endorphins during exercise can help improve mood, boost self-esteem, and increase overall happiness.

Moreover, exercise has shown to be an effective stress reliever. When we engage in physical activity, our body releases tension and stress, leading to a sense of relaxation. This helps in reducing the levels of stress hormones, such as cortisol, which are responsible for feelings of anxiety and tension. Regular exercise can also improve our ability to cope with stress, making us better equipped to handle the challenges that life throws at us.

One surprising benefit of exercise on mental health is its ability to enhance cognitive function. Physical activity has been linked to improved memory, attention, and decision-making skills. Studies have found that regular exercise promotes the growth of new brain cells, particularly in the hippocampus, the area of the brain associated with memory and learning. In addition, exercise increases blood flow to the brain, delivering more oxygen and nutrients, resulting in improved brain health and cognitive function.

Furthermore, exercise has been found to promote better sleep, which is crucial for our mental well-being. Regular physical activity can help regulate our sleep patterns, making it easier to fall asleep and improve the quality of our sleep. A good night’s sleep significantly impacts our mood, energy, and overall mental health.
